How Much Does a Nose Piercing Cost?

How Much Does a Nose Piercing Cost?

Thinking about getting a nose piercing? If so, you're probably wondering how much it's going to cost. The answer to that question depends on a few factors, including the type of piercing you want, the jewelry you choose, and the location of the piercing studio. In this article, we'll break down the average cost of nose piercings and provide some tips for saving money on your piercing.

The average cost of a nose piercing is between $20 and $80. However, the price can vary depending on the factors mentioned above. For example, a simple nostril piercing will typically cost less than a septum piercing. Additionally, the type of jewelry you choose can also affect the price. For example, a gold nose ring will typically cost more than a silver one.

Now that you know the average cost of a nose piercing, let's talk about how you can save money on your piercing. One way to save money is to shop around for a piercing studio. Prices can vary significantly from one studio to another, so it's worth doing your research to find the best deal. Another way to save money is to choose a simple piercing and jewelry. The more elaborate the piercing and jewelry, the more you're going to pay.

Aftercare Costs: Include Saline Solution and Antibacterial Soap

In addition to the cost of the piercing itself, you will also need to factor in the cost of aftercare supplies. These supplies can include saline solution, antibacterial soap, and cotton balls.

Saline solution: Saline solution is a sterile salt water solution that is used to clean and disinfect the piercing. It is important to use saline solution twice a day, morning and night. You can purchase saline solution at most drugstores or online.

Antibacterial soap: Antibacterial soap is used to wash your hands before touching the piercing. It is also important to wash the piercing with antibacterial soap once a day. You can purchase antibacterial soap at most drugstores or online.

Cotton balls: Cotton balls are used to apply the saline solution and antibacterial soap to the piercing. You can purchase cotton balls at most drugstores or online.

The cost of aftercare supplies can vary depending on the brand and the quantity that you purchase. However, you can expect to spend around $10-$20 on aftercare supplies.

Tips

Here are a few tips for getting a nose piercing:

Tip 1: Do your research.
Before you get a nose piercing, it's important to do your research and find a reputable piercing studio. Read reviews online, ask for recommendations from friends or family, and visit the studio in person to make sure it's clean and professional.

Tip 2: Choose a simple piercing and jewelry.
If you're on a budget, choose a simple piercing and jewelry. The more elaborate the piercing and jewelry, the more you're going to pay. Additionally, simple piercings and jewelry are typically easier to care for.

Tip 3: Take care of your piercing properly.
After you get your nose pierced, it's important to take care of it properly to avoid complications. This includes cleaning the piercing twice a day with saline solution, avoiding touching the piercing with dirty hands, and avoiding swimming or soaking in water for the first few weeks.

Tip 4: Be patient.
It takes time for a nose piercing to heal completely. Be patient and follow your piercer's aftercare instructions carefully. It can take up to 6 months for a nose piercing to fully heal.
